리눅스 PC 로 방화벽 만들기

koreahjg의 이미지

안녕하세요
제가 요즘 리눅스 iptable 관련 내용을 보고 있는데요
리눅스 방화벽을 개인PC 방화벽 용도가 아니라도
게이트웨이 레벨에서 방화벽으로도 쓸수있는 기능들이 많은것 같은데
정작 그런 방화벽을 설치? 세팅? 하려면 어떤식으로 해야할지 모르겠어요

게이트웨이에 대해서 찾아보니 게이트웨이용 서버프로그램이 있다는데
그걸 설치하고 네트웍 안에 있는 호스트들의 게이트웨이를 게이트웨이 프로그램 깔린 PC의 IP로 설정하면 될것같은
느낌이 나는데 확실히 알려주셨으면 좋겠어요^^

그리고 방화벽도 게이트웨이와 호스트들을 연결하는것처럼
방화벽과 게이트웨이를 연결하면 방화벽 프로그램의 룰이 적용되는건가요??
인터넷 찾아봐도 관련내용이 잘 안나와서 직접글을 올립니다..

질문요약.
1. 개인 PC로 게이트웨이 구축 방법?
2. 개인 PC로 방화벽 구축 방법?

visualplus의 이미지

1. 개인 pc로 게이트웨이 구축 방법?
WAN과 LAN이 서로 같은것처럼 게이트웨이도 똑같은것입니다.
그냥 상대 pc에서 게이트웨이를 님 pc ip로 설정하면 님 pc는 게이트웨이가 된 것 입니다.
게이트웨이는 동일 라인에 있고 인터넷에 연결 되어있는 컴퓨터.. 정도로 생각하시면 될 듯 한데..
그냥 패킷을 받아 라우팅테이블에 의해 외부로 패킷을 보내주는게 게이트웨이입니다.
( 이 외에 NAT나 방화벽 등 몇가지 기능들이 추가되면 더 강력한 게이트웨이가 되겠지요. )

2. 개인 pc로 방화벽 구축 방법?
리눅스로 하실거면 그냥 iptables가 깔려있으면 방화벽인것입니다.
님이 어떤 기능을 원하시는진 모르겠지만 iptables기본 기능만으론 만족스런 방화벽 구축을 못하실텐데..
아마 patch-o-matic을 검색 하시면 많은 문서들이 나올겁니다. 이걸 참조 해 보세요^^

참고로 iptables에는 input, output, forward가 있는데 보통 게이트웨이에서 방화벽을 사용하실것이라면 forward패킷을
컨트롤 하시면 됩니다.

primewizard의 이미지

댓글 달기

Filtered HTML

  • 텍스트에 BBCode 태그를 사용할 수 있습니다. URL은 자동으로 링크 됩니다.
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param><hr>
  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.

BBCode

  • 텍스트에 BBCode 태그를 사용할 수 있습니다. URL은 자동으로 링크 됩니다.
  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param>
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.

Textile

  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• You can use Textile markup to format text.
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param><hr>

Markdown

  • 다음 태그를 이용하여 소스 코드 구문 강조를 할 수 있습니다: <code>, <blockcode>, <apache>, <applescript>, <autoconf>, <awk>, <bash>, <c>, <cpp>, <css>, <diff>, <drupal5>, <drupal6>, <gdb>, <html>, <html5>, <java>, <javascript>, <ldif>, <lua>, <make>, <mysql>, <perl>, <perl6>, <php>, <pgsql>, <proftpd>, <python>, <reg>, <spec>, <ruby>. 지원하는 태그 형식: <foo>, [foo].
  • Quick Tips:
    • Two or more spaces at a line's end = Line break
    • Double returns = Paragraph
    • *Single asterisks* or _single underscores_ = Emphasis
    • **Double** or __double__ = Strong
    • This is [a link](http://the.link.example.com "The optional title text")
    For complete details on the Markdown syntax, see the Markdown documentation and Markdown Extra documentation for tables, footnotes, and more.
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.
  • 사용할 수 있는 HTML 태그: <p><div><span><br><a><em><strong><del><ins><b><i><u><s><pre><code><cite><blockquote><ul><ol><li><dl><dt><dd><table><tr><td><th><thead><tbody><h1><h2><h3><h4><h5><h6><img><embed><object><param><hr>

Plain text

  • HTML 태그를 사용할 수 없습니다.
  • web 주소와/이메일 주소를 클릭할 수 있는 링크로 자동으로 바꿉니다.
  • 줄과 단락은 자동으로 분리됩니다.
댓글 첨부 파일
이 댓글에 이미지나 파일을 업로드 합니다.
파일 크기는 8 MB보다 작아야 합니다.
허용할 파일 형식: txt pdf doc xls gif jpg jpeg mp3 png rar zip.
CAPTCHA
이것은 자동으로 스팸을 올리는 것을 막기 위해서 제공됩니다.